CNC Machinist Job Description
Job Summary
We are seeking a skilled CNC Machinist to join our manufacturing team. The ideal candidate will have a strong mechanical knowledge and experience in CNC programming, operating CNC lathes and milling machines, and reading blueprints.
Reporting to the Lead Machinist, the Machinist is responsible for the machining of metal parts that meet dimensional specifications of mechanical engineered drawings.
Responsibilities
- Use manual, semi-automated, and CNC machinery such as lathes, milling machines, and grinders, to produce precision metal parts.
- Review samples, drawings or instructions to understand specifications of output.
- Plan the sequence of necessary actions for the completion of a job.
- Take measurements and mark material for machining.
- Select appropriate machines (e.g. lathes) and position or load material for a job.
- Determine and program size of batches, speed of machine, etc.
- Monitor machine while working to adjust the feed, maintain temperature and identify issues.
- Check output to ensure consistency with specifications and discard defects.
- When required perform grinding, sanding and polishing.
- Keep records of approved and defective units or final products.
- Perform routine machine maintenance and repair minor damages.
- Check quality of machined product to ensure it is defect-free and ready for subsequent production steps.
- Monitor condition and quantity of machining tools and other related supplies and report to the Lead Machinist when replenishment is needed.
- Use a crane, pallet mover, or forklift to relocate processed parts, bins, or skids to a designated area for further production steps or shipping area if completed.
- Keep all work areas clean and organized.
- Clean up and maintain the immediate work area in a neat and orderly fashion.
- Complete records as required.
- Detect faulty equipment, improper operations, and unusual conditions and report it to supervisor.
Qualifications
- Proven experience as a CNC Machinist or similar role in a manufacturing environment.
- Strong mechanical knowledge with the ability to troubleshoot equipment issues effectively.
- Ability to read blueprints, schematics and manuals
- Basic math skills for accurate measurements and calculations during machining processes.
- Ability to operate forklifts safely is advantageous.
- Ability to use precision tools (e.g. callipers) to take accurate measurements
- Knowledge of the properties of metal and other material
